Celebrate and make homemade rockets! Friday, July 3, 2015. Celebrate Independence Day making homemade rockets using toilet paper rolls and paper towel rolls! Start by collecting the empty toilet paper rolls and paper towel rolls! Besides the rolls, you'll need album paper, glitter paper, ribbons, pony beads, glue and stapler. Cut the glitter paper in a 6" semi-circle. I made a template and cut 3 at a time! The curve will be the bottom and straight line will be the top. Curl and staple together. Glue the ...
